Doctrine ORM also allows you to provide the ORM metadata in the form of plain
PHP code using the ClassMetadata API. You can write the code in inside of a
static function named loadMetadata($class) on the entity class itself.
In addition to other drivers using configuration languages you can also programatically specify your mapping information inside of a static function defined on the entity class itself.
This is useful for cases where you want to keep your entity and mapping
information together but don't want to use attributes. For this you just
need to use the StaticPHPDriver:
.. code-block:: php
<?php
use Doctrine\Persistence\Mapping\Driver\StaticPHPDriver;
$driver = new StaticPHPDriver('/path/to/entities');
$em->getConfiguration()->setMetadataDriverImpl($driver);
Now you just need to define a static function named
loadMetadata($metadata) on your entity:
.. code-block:: php
<?php
namespace Entities;
use Doctrine\ORM\Mapping\ClassMetadata;
class User
{
// ...
public static function loadMetadata(ClassMetadata $metadata)
{
$metadata->mapField(array(
'id' => true,
'fieldName' => 'id',
'type' => 'integer'
));
$metadata->mapField(array(
'fieldName' => 'username',
'type' => 'string'
));
}
}
To ease the use of the ClassMetadata API (which is very raw) there is a ClassMetadataBuilder that you can use.
.. code-block:: php
<?php
namespace Entities;
use Doctrine\ORM\Mapping\ClassMetadata;
use Doctrine\ORM\Mapping\Builder\ClassMetadataBuilder;
class User
{
// ...
public static function loadMetadata(ClassMetadata $metadata)
{
$builder = new ClassMetadataBuilder($metadata);
$builder->createField('id', 'integer')->isPrimaryKey()->generatedValue()->build();
$builder->addField('username', 'string');
}
}
The API of the ClassMetadataBuilder has the following methods with a fluent interface:
addField($name, $type, array $mapping)setMappedSuperclass()setReadOnly()setCustomRepositoryClass($className)setTable($name)addIndex(array $columns, $indexName)addUniqueConstraint(array $columns, $constraintName)setJoinedTableInheritance()setSingleTableInheritance()setDiscriminatorColumn($name, $type = 'string', $length = 255, $columnDefinition = null, $enumType = null, $options = [])addDiscriminatorMapClass($name, $class)setChangeTrackingPolicyDeferredExplicit()addLifecycleEvent($methodName, $event)addManyToOne($name, $targetEntity, $inversedBy = null)addInverseOneToOne($name, $targetEntity, $mappedBy)addOwningOneToOne($name, $targetEntity, $inversedBy = null)addOwningManyToMany($name, $targetEntity, $inversedBy = null)addInverseManyToMany($name, $targetEntity, $mappedBy)addOneToMany($name, $targetEntity, $mappedBy)It also has several methods that create builders (which are necessary for advanced mappings):
createField($name, $type) returns a FieldBuilder instancecreateManyToOne($name, $targetEntity) returns an AssociationBuilder instancecreateOneToOne($name, $targetEntity) returns an AssociationBuilder instancecreateManyToMany($name, $targetEntity) returns an ManyToManyAssociationBuilder instancecreateOneToMany($name, $targetEntity) returns an OneToManyAssociationBuilder instanceThe ClassMetadata class is the data object for storing the mapping
